Default Interior removal instructions

I'm going to remove the front seats and carpet to lay down some insulation. I don't have a shop manual. Does anyone have a schematic, instructions, tips, warnings, etc? The center console looks like a beast to remove.

You dont have to remove the center console in order to remove the carpet.First , undo the front seat belt and you must remove the seat belt tensioner.Once you have done that you have to remove 4 bolts that hold the seat down and dont forget to disconnect the plug under the seat. . Remove the seat and be very careful not to hit your door panel.Remove only the lower back seat by simply pull up hard on the lower cushion.You have to remove all the scuff plates and then you can start removing the carpet.The center console doesn't have to be removed but the rear portion need to be loosened.In the armrest area there are 2 screws and then you simply have to pull up the tray and you will see a few more bolts that need to be removed and the rear portion of the center console will be loose enough to remove the carpet..Hope this helps..

There is a plastic cover around the shifter itself. You slide it down, you may need to pull hard. There are two phillips screws. Slide the shifter off.
Then you pop the shifter console wood trim out, but only after removing the ash tray cig lighter area which also snaps out. Then inside the armrest console there is a piece of felt that looks like its the bottom of the tray. It actually pulls out to reveal two 10mm bolts. I think I forgot two steps but once you start to pull it out you'll see what you've got ahead of you.
